Ironbridge covers six square miles of the Ironbridge
Gorge near Telford
The first iron rails, wheels, steam train, and boats and
site of the first cast-iron bridge often linked to the start of the Industrial Revolution
in Britain.
The Ironbridge Gorge Museum Trust has 8 museums
covering a total of 80 acres. The Iron Bridge and Tollhouse, Blists Hill Victorian Town,
Museum of iron and Darby Furnace, the Darby Houses, Museum of the Gorge, Coalport china
museum, Jackfield Tile Museum, Broseley Pipeworks, Clay tobacco pipe museum and the teddy
bear shop.
The Which? Guide listed the Ironbridge Gorge Museums
amongst the UK's best Outdoor Attractions. |
